Definition and Meaning
The "Assessment of Drain Inlet" typically refers to a comprehensive evaluation process initiated by organizations, such as the California Department of Transportation, to monitor and manage the cleanliness and functionality of drain inlets. These assessments involve reviewing the operational conditions of drain inlets, evaluating waste management methods, and ensuring that maintenance activities comply with environmental regulations. The aim is to prevent clogging and environmental contamination and to promote efficient water flow through drainage systems.
How to Use the Assessment of Drain Inlet
To utilize an "Assessment of Drain Inlet," users typically follow a structured procedure involving several steps. These steps include identifying the specific drain inlet under review, conducting physical inspections to check for blockages or structural damages, and measuring waste accumulation. Following this, users gather data for analysis, which often requires monitoring the efficiency of waste removal processes, typically using specialized equipment like Vactor trucks. Finally, assessments usually conclude with assembling findings into a report format, recommending best practices for future maintenance and management.
Steps to Complete the Assessment of Drain Inlet
-
Site Inspection: Begin by visiting the drain inlet location to assess its physical condition. Look for signs of blockage, structural damage, or waste accumulation.
-
Data Collection: Gather relevant data, such as waste type and volume at decanting sites. This can involve using equipment like Vactor trucks for precise measurements.
-
Analysis: Analyze the collected data to determine adherence to regulatory standards. Look for deviations from expected waste criteria, especially hazardous waste levels.
-
Recommendations: Provide actionable recommendations for improvements in waste management practices. This might involve suggesting new cleaning schedules or equipment adjustments.
-
Documentation: Compile the assessment findings into a comprehensive report. Ensure it covers all observed elements, methods, and quality controls applied.

Important Terms Related to Assessment of Drain Inlet
- Vactor Trucks: Specialized vehicles used for clearing debris from inlets using powerful suction.
- Decanting Sites: Areas designated for the segregation and disposal of collected waste from drain inlets.
- Regulatory Limits: State-imposed thresholds for determining compliant levels of waste materials in environmental surveys.
